Manager of Community Health - Make a Difference!

Are you a passionate leader looking to make a real impact on a vibrant community? CHI St. Joseph is seeking a dynamic and dedicated Manager of Community Health to lead our program and champion the health and well-being of our community.

As the Manager of Community Health, you will be responsible for the overall direction, coordination, and evaluation of all programs and services administered by the department. This is a unique opportunity to shape the future of public health in Hubbard County and work collaboratively with North Country Community Health Services (CHS) to deliver essential services.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Strategic Leadership:Provide visionary leadership and strategic direction for the Department, ensuring alignment with the MN Public Health Statute and the needs of the community.
  • Program Development & Management:Plan, develop, implement, and direct a comprehensive range of public health programs and services for Hubbard County.
  • Financial Stewardship:Prepare and manage departmental budgets, oversee grant work plan and financial management, and ensure responsible allocation of resources.
  • Community Health Improvement:Identify community health needs, develop and implement Community Health Improvement Plans (CHIP), and actively participate in the CHS Strategic Plan and Quality Improvement programming.
  • Team Leadership:Supervise, mentor, and evaluate staff, fostering a positive and productive work environment. Manage work schedules, caseload assignments, and administer personnel policies.
  • Collaboration & Coordination:Coordinate public health services with other public and private agencies, serving as an advisor to the North Country CHS agency.
  • Emergency Preparedness:Coordinate the department's response efforts during emergencies, ensuring the safety and well-being of the community.
  • Community Engagement:Attend and participate in relevant public health meetings, provide educational trainings, and promote positive community awareness regarding available services and health prevention/promotion topics.
  • Performance Evaluation:Evaluate the quality and productivity of services and grants through data analysis, reports, and cost studies, working in conjunction with staff, grant managers, and the North Country CHS.
  • Policy Development & Review:Develop and review departmental policies to ensure compliance and effectiveness.
  • Outcomes Reporting:Ensure accurate and timely reporting of program outcomes and performance metrics.

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in nursing required
  • Active MN RN License required
  • Public Health Experience Preferred

CHI St. Joseph’s Health of Park Rapids, part of CommonSpirit Health, is an award-winning, 25-bed critical access hospital located in the heart of lake country. Fully accredited by The Joint Commission, we offer a full range of services including 24/7/365 Emergency Department and Level IV Trauma Center, hospitalist program, testing, surgery, orthopedics, rehabilitation, and more so that you can experience better health. CommonSpirit Health was formed by the alignment of Catholic Health Initiatives (CHI) and Dignity Health. With more than 700 care sites across the U.S., from clinics and hospitals to home-based care and virtual care services, CommonSpirit is accessible to nearly one out of every four U.S. residents.
